Abstract
Voltage comparators for actuating a camera shutter and a low-light indicating lamp respectively have inputs connected to junctions between photocells and resistors so as to be controlled in response to the light level. The voltage comparator for the low-light indicator energizes the indicator when the light level is below a low-light value from the time the shutter release button is partially depressed until the time the shutter is closed after the exposure. The voltage comparator for the shutter produces a shutter opening signal to open the shutter for the required length of time based on the light level. The output of the voltage comparator for the shutter is connected through a diode to the input of the voltage comparator for the low-light indicator so that the low light indicator is deenergized when the shutter is closed.
